Motorizations for satellite dishes mod. HH90
Rotor SAT HH is a motor that
allows to point any satellite dish towards all visible satellites in the polar
orbit. The characteristics that make Rotor SAT HH particularly valid are as
follows:

  • Maximum precision
  • Mechanical robustness
  • Connection without external feeding, only by coaxial cable
  • Reduced dimensions
  • Maximum easiness of installation

Rotor SAT HH is directly controlled by DiSEqC1.2 or USALS compatible
receivers , where the rotation of the motor automatically begin when selecting
the required channel. For all those receiver not providet with DiSEqC, STAB has
developed the interfaces MS 220, MP 01, MP 02 (page.5) to drive the motors bythe
Tv cable.

Infinity USB Unlimited

/tmp/con-5cb27041e3b4a/2645_Product.jpg

The next generation of smartcard programmers…
The Infinity USB Unlimited supports phoenix-based cards over USB. It has two smartcard connectors (regular and SIM/GSM), a fullspeed USB 2.0 interface and a very powerful firmware-upgradable CPU ensures that this programmer has no limitations.

Phoenix / Smartmouse mode
A stepless frequency generator has been added making it possible to generate clock-frequencies in Phoenix and Smartmouse mode from 0,1MHz to more than 100MHz including the mostly used 3.58, 3.68 and 6.00MHz. Both phoenix and smartmouse mode is supported.
In addition to the direct native support of most Phoenix-based cards in the Infinity USB Unlimited software, the VCP-mode (Virtual COMport) makes it possible to use most of the existing 3rd party software, that currently requires a Phoenix/Smartmouse compatible programmer thru a (serial) COMport. Different VCP profiles are available to ensure optimal compatibility with specific 3rd party software.

Multiprogrammer mode
Connect 2 or more Infinity USB Unlimited to your PC, and you’ll be able to write as many cards as you have programmers connected, at the same time. It will just take the time of 1 card, even if you have 10 programmers connected, writing 10 cards at the same time. 
Up to 127 Infinity USB Unlimited (only limited by the number of available USB ports) can be controlled by the same software. For users needing to write a high amount of cards this is an ideal solution.
Additional programmers are automatically detected and you’ll be able to name each programmer to keep track of which is which.
